Adam Sprein
Track & Field
Our male selection for May is sophomore runner Adam
Sprein. A strong runner for the Cuesta program the last two seasons, Sprein has
kicked it into high gear at the end of his sophomore campaign. He is one of
only two Cuesta athletes competing in three events at this weekend’s 2003
Southern California Regional Finals and will compete in the 200-meter dash, the
110 hurdles and the 4 x 100 relay. He finished second in the Western State
Conference (WSC) Championships in the 110 hurdles (:14.72) and third in the 200
meters (:21.6) to qualify for the post-season event. His time in the hurdles is
the 7th fastest in the State this year and his relay team should challenge the
school record set in 1977.
The Cougars finished third in the WSC and have sent
15 athletes onto the 2003 Southern California Regional Finals.
Track & Field
Our female selection for May is freshman Runner
Christina Reyes, a dominant force in the world of Community College Track and
Field. She is the 2003 Western State Conference (WSC) Champion in the 800 and
1,500 meter runs and was second in the 5,000 meter. She has qualified for the
2003 Southern California Regional Finals in all three events. Reyes currently
ranks fourth in the State in the 800 (2:15.5) and fifth in both the 1500
(4:47.00) and, 5,000 (18:05).
